So the first run through I did the ending which gets you Eliza as a runner.
Much later I got a contract to the church where you find them (St. Andrew's?). When I get there I still had dialogue box options related to Sara/Eliza and I was able to turn Eliza and her mom in to Mars and collect the reward. That was handy. I got Eliza, 125,000 creds and 50 rep or whatever it is. I can't imagine how much rep I'll lose when Mars realizes the Krofters I gave them were just a couple of street urchins I stunned and had their facial features reconstructed in a shady street clinic.
I don't know if this works in every game. I do remember in the first play through that I clicked a dialogue box and ended up repeating a section of the dialogue with Sara and was afraid that maybe I had screwed things up. That might have triggered the appearance of the discussion options later on. I don't know.
